Cybersecurity: Fortifying Our Digital Defenses in an Interconnected Era
In today's increasingly tangled world, cybersecurity has become paramount. As our reliance on digital systems grows exponentially, so does the threat posed by malicious actors. From criticalsystems to sensitive data, everything is vulnerable to cyberattacks. To counter these threats, we must implement robust cybersecurity strategies.
A comprehensive cybersecurity approach should encompass multiple levels, including network security, here application security, and user awareness. Remaining informed about the latest vulnerabilities and embracing best practices are crucial for individuals and organizations alike. By working together to strengthen our digital defenses, we can create a safer and more protected online environment.
Augmenting Humanity: The Promise and Peril of Technological Enhancement
Technological developments have consistently reshaped human civilization. From the creation of fire to the advent of the internet, each leap forward has modified our world in profound ways. Today, we stand on the threshold of a new era, one where technology promises to augment human abilities like never before. This opportunity is both exhilarating and daunting, holding within it the promise of unimaginable progress but also the risk of unintended consequences.
- Biotechnology offers the potential to cure diseases, lengthen lifespans, and even enhance our physical traits.
- Artificial intelligence could revolutionize fields, optimizing tasks and freeing humans to pursue more intellectual endeavors.
- Molecular Manipulation promises to create materials with unprecedented durability and unlock new frontiers in medicine, manufacturing, and beyond.
However, these same technologies raise profound ethical dilemnas. Who gets access to these enhancements, and at what cost? Will inequality be exacerbated, creating a divide between the modified and the ordinary? How do we ensure that artificial intelligence remains aligned with human values and doesn't pose an existential threat?
The future of humanity hinges on our ability to navigate these complex issues responsibly. We must engage in open and honest dialogue about the implications of technological augmentation, ensuring that it serves the common good and benefits all of humanity.
Smart Cities, Smarter Living: Building Sustainable Urban Environments with Tech
As our global population aggregates in urban centers, the need for innovative solutions to create sustainable and livable cities rises. Smart cities leverage cutting-edge technology to enhance various aspects of urban life, from infrastructure management to citizen engagement. Through the integration of data analytics, sensor networks, and artificial intelligence, smart cities aim to cultivate a more efficient, resilient, and green urban environment.
- Smart transportation systems can decrease traffic congestion and air contamination, leading to improved air quality and reduced fuel consumption.
- Smart grids can allocate energy usage, integrating renewable sources and reducing dependence on fossil fuels.
- Citizen engagement platforms can enable real-time communication between residents and city officials, allowing for more open governance and responsive service delivery.
By embracing these technological advancements, cities can create a future where urban living is not only convenient but also environmentally responsible and socially inclusive.
